diff options
author | Rick Farina <zerochaos@gentoo.org> | 2015-05-03 04:45:41 +0000 |
---|---|---|
committer | Rick Farina <zerochaos@gentoo.org> | 2015-05-03 04:45:41 +0000 |
commit | 4eed4ea7aea12891b456ece4a4790a0fa9a6ea36 (patch) | |
tree | 100239bdb22380cc5e88753e98cc1515b90c4c54 /net-wireless | |
parent | sys-proclaim is now on unconditionally, closing #548060 (diff) | |
download | gentoo-2-4eed4ea7aea12891b456ece4a4790a0fa9a6ea36.tar.gz gentoo-2-4eed4ea7aea12891b456ece4a4790a0fa9a6ea36.tar.bz2 gentoo-2-4eed4ea7aea12891b456ece4a4790a0fa9a6ea36.zip |
changed from python dfu to C dfu implementation
(Portage version: 2.2.18/cvs/Linux x86_64, signed Manifest commit with key DD11F94A)
Diffstat (limited to 'net-wireless')
-rw-r--r-- | net-wireless/ubertooth/ChangeLog | 5 | ||||
-rw-r--r-- | net-wireless/ubertooth/ubertooth-9999.ebuild | 17 |
2 files changed, 9 insertions, 13 deletions
diff --git a/net-wireless/ubertooth/ChangeLog b/net-wireless/ubertooth/ChangeLog index fcbb479b01c9..623b918d3d98 100644 --- a/net-wireless/ubertooth/ChangeLog +++ b/net-wireless/ubertooth/ChangeLog @@ -1,6 +1,9 @@ # ChangeLog for net-wireless/ubertooth #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/net-wireless/ubertooth/ChangeLog,v 1.28 2015/03/19 21:51:22 zerochaos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-wireless/ubertooth/ChangeLog,v 1.29 2015/05/03 04:45:41 zerochaos Exp $ + + 03 May 2015; Rick Farina <zerochaos@gentoo.org> ubertooth-9999.ebuild: + changed from python dfu to C dfu implementation 19 Mar 2015; Rick Farina <zerochaos@gentoo.org> ubertooth-9999.ebuild: update pcap dep properly. upstream should add some better flags for diff --git a/net-wireless/ubertooth/ubertooth-9999.ebuild b/net-wireless/ubertooth/ubertooth-9999.ebuild index ac43c0574bb1..b823609adc4a 100644 --- a/net-wireless/ubertooth/ubertooth-9999.ebuild +++ b/net-wireless/ubertooth/ubertooth-9999.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2015 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/net-wireless/ubertooth/ubertooth-9999.ebuild,v 1.27 2015/03/19 21:51:22 zerochaos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-wireless/ubertooth/ubertooth-9999.ebuild,v 1.28 2015/05/03 04:45:41 zerochaos Exp $ EAPI="5" @@ -14,11 +14,9 @@ HOMEPAGE="http://ubertooth.sourceforge.net/" LICENSE="GPL-2" SLOT="0" -IUSE="+bluez +dfu +specan +pcap +python +ubertooth1-firmware +udev" -REQUIRED_USE="dfu? ( python ) - specan? ( python ) - ubertooth1-firmware? ( dfu ) - python? ( || ( dfu specan ) )" +IUSE="+bluez +specan +pcap +python +ubertooth1-firmware +udev" +REQUIRED_USE=" specan? ( python ) + python? ( specan )" DEPEND="bluez? ( net-wireless/bluez:= ) >=net-libs/libbtbb-${PV}:= pcap? ( net-libs/libbtbb[pcap] ) @@ -28,7 +26,6 @@ RDEPEND="${DEPEND} >=dev-python/pyside-1.0.2 >=dev-python/numpy-1.3 >=dev-python/pyusb-1.0.0_alpha1 ) - dfu? ( >=dev-python/pyusb-1.0.0_alpha1 ) udev? ( virtual/udev )" MY_PV=${PV/\./-} @@ -53,10 +50,6 @@ pkg_setup() { if use python; then python_pkg_setup; DISTUTILS_SETUP_FILES=() - if use dfu; then - DISTUTILS_SETUP_FILES+=("${S}/python/usb_dfu|setup.py") - PYTHON_MODNAME="dfu" - fi if use specan; then DISTUTILS_SETUP_FILES+=("${S}/python/specan_ui|setup.py") PYTHON_MODNAME+=" specan" @@ -72,7 +65,7 @@ src_prepare() { src_configure() { mycmakeargs=( $(cmake-utils_use_enable bluez USE_BLUEZ) - $(cmake-utils_use_enable pcap USE_PCAP) + $(cmake-utils_use pcap USE_PCAP) $(cmake-utils_use_enable udev INSTALL_UDEV_RULES) -DDISABLE_PYTHON=true ) |